Audi hybrid takes pole for Le Mans 24 hour

2012-le-mans-24-hour-qualifying.jpg

Audi has taken pole position for the Le Man 24 Hour race with its new R18 e-tron quattro, with André Lotterer beating last year’s best time by nearly two seconds. Audi qualified second and sixth with the Audi R18 ultra and first and fourth with the two R18 e-tron quattros. Toyota’s TS030 hybrids managed third and fifth to set up an interesting battle of with hybrids filling four of the top five grid placings.
